summaryrefslogtreecommitdiff
path: root/src_ui_overrides
diff options
context:
space:
mode:
authorVinit Nayak <peanutbutter@google.com>2021-02-22 14:49:27 -0800
committerVinit Nayak <peanutbutter@google.com>2021-03-15 15:42:32 -0700
commitd987a828e8fb328a7da976e9e86a259e65eb1f20 (patch)
tree428bdfba07ebcc005ef93d1559a4839fe1814e67 /src_ui_overrides
parent510fc67c559cedc05fb8d6780f9e566b1e0e2cb8 (diff)
downloadLauncher3-d987a828e8fb328a7da976e9e86a259e65eb1f20.tar.gz
Initial commit of new split screen work.
TODO: * Extract out common elements in TaskShortcutFactory.MultiWindowFactory for commonalities between new and old way of invoking split screen * Integrate with WM APIs (b/182002789) * Write tests for SplitSelectStateController Bug: 181704764 Change-Id: Ice35adb4ea82897f5e2433dc9b93a549f3d511b5
Diffstat (limited to 'src_ui_overrides')
-rw-r--r--src_ui_overrides/com/android/launcher3/uioverrides/states/OverviewState.java7
1 files changed, 7 insertions, 0 deletions
diff --git a/src_ui_overrides/com/android/launcher3/uioverrides/states/OverviewState.java b/src_ui_overrides/com/android/launcher3/uioverrides/states/OverviewState.java
index da5a94f6fd..e85e505f35 100644
--- a/src_ui_overrides/com/android/launcher3/uioverrides/states/OverviewState.java
+++ b/src_ui_overrides/com/android/launcher3/uioverrides/states/OverviewState.java
@@ -49,4 +49,11 @@ public class OverviewState extends LauncherState {
public static OverviewState newModalTaskState(int id) {
return new OverviewState(id);
}
+
+ /**
+ * New Overview substate that represents the overview in modal mode (one task shown on its own)
+ */
+ public static OverviewState newSplitSelectState(int id) {
+ return new OverviewState(id);
+ }
}